Skip navigation

Un pezzo di uno script PHP che interroga un Web Service che restituisce informazioni su una città (fuso orario, nome, etc) sapendo le sue coordinate (latitudine e longitudine).

<?
// Costruisco l’URL
$lat = “45.28”;
$lon = “9.10”;
// Richiamo l’URL e catturo l’output XML

$dati = simplexml_load_file($url);
// Stampo il contenuto del blocco <offset>
echo $dati->offset;
// Fine

?>

Il servizio restituisce in output un file XML cosi:

<timezone xsi:noNamespaceSchemaLocation=”http://www.earthtools.org/timezone-1.1.xsd”&gt;
<version>1.1</version>
<location>
<latitude>45.28</latitude>
<longitude>9.10</longitude>
</location>
<offset>1</offset>
<suffix>A</suffix>
<localtime>6 Feb 2008 11:50:06</localtime>
<isotime>2008-02-06 11:50:06 +0100</isotime>
<utctime>2008-02-06 10:50:06</utctime>
<dst>False</dst>
</timezone>


Lascia un commento

Inserisci i tuoi dati qui sotto o clicca su un'icona per effettuare l'accesso:

Logo WordPress.com

Stai commentando usando il tuo account WordPress.com. Chiudi sessione / Modifica )

Foto Twitter

Stai commentando usando il tuo account Twitter. Chiudi sessione / Modifica )

Foto di Facebook

Stai commentando usando il tuo account Facebook. Chiudi sessione / Modifica )

Google+ photo

Stai commentando usando il tuo account Google+. Chiudi sessione / Modifica )

Connessione a %s...

%d blogger cliccano Mi Piace per questo: